This week I finally finished Dan Brown’s latest book, The Lost Symbol. You can read my full review here, but in a word, I was disappointed. For all the hype, it certainly did not live up. Considering I finished The Da Vinci Code in 2 days and absolutely loved it, the fact that it took me over 3 weeks to finish the latest book was not a good sign.

Speaking of hard-to-finish books, I have noticed in the past few months that when I finish a book that I would only rate mediocre, it puts me into somewhat of a reading slump. It takes me longer to pick up another book and read. I especially noticed this during the summer months. I picked up pace after I finished The Time Traveler’s Wife, which is probably the best book I’ve read all year. Finishing a wonderful book always reminds me why I love reading in the first place, and so I’m always eager to pick up another book. This time, after finishing Dan Brown’s book, I had time to read the following nights I just had no gumption to pick up another book. Does this happen to you?

Last night I started Queen of Babble in the Big City by Meg Cabot, and I will finish it today. It’s such a cute, easy read, and I love the main character, Lizzie. She has such a big mouth and cannot keep secrets, but so far in this book she’s doing quite well holding her tongue. I chose this book off my shelf of dozens last night because I wanted to read more about New York, because we’re heading there on vacation this week! I have never been there and I cannot wait to go!
